Emergency Services: Dispatchers are essential to Carson City's public safety response

A 911 phone call to the Carson City Communications Division is a lifeline moment where someone on the other end needs immediate help. The dispatchers on the other end are known as the first, first responders.

Possible gas leak in neighborhood prompts brief Fremont Elementary evacuation

UPDATE 9:12AM: Surrounding areas near Fremont where there were reports of a strong gas odor have been given the "all clear," according to a Carson City Fire Department battalion chief. The unidentified odor was neither propane or natural gas.
***
UPDATE 8:31AM: Southwest Gas has given the "all clear" at Fremont Elementary where there was a report of a possible gas leak. No leaks were found. Students who were bused to Carson Middle School will be returning to Fremont, said Dan Davis, spokesman for Carson City School District.
***

More than 20 reports of possible gas leaks have been made Tuesday morning around Carson City, including a strong odor at Fremont Elementary School where there has been an evacuation of students.

Carson City emergency crews respond to apartment fire on Silver Oak Drive

UPDATE: 6:55AM: The apartment fire at the Broadleaf Apartments has been extinguished, Carson City Fire Department Battalion Chief Tom Raw said.
The fire started within a heating unit inside a laundry room at the complex, Raw said. The flames were extinguished about 6 a.m., within minutes of fire crews arriving on scene.
No injuries were reported.
***
Multiple engines with the Carson City Fire Department were dispatched early Sunday morning to the Broadleaf Manor Apartments, 777 Silver Oak Drive in North Carson City, on report of a structure fire.
